Fumigation Originally, the fumigation division of Paratex started as a ship supply business on the Seattle waterfront in 1908. The company was soon called upon to place sulfur pots in the holds of ships to eliminate any residual rat populations from foreign ports. We currently maintain a vacuum fumigation chamber at Paratex in our Seattle facilty at 423 S. Horton St. This facility is used for both USDA Quarantine Import requirements and the export requirements to foreign countries. It is also available to the general public for fumigation of antiques with wood beetles, carpets with moths and general household items with infestation. Paratex has years of experience working with USDA, WSDA and various foreign governments to meet import/export requirements of goods and commodities. We can assist with drayage to and from the various piers and transloading when required.
